The Origin and Spread of the Surname Bacchin
The surname Bacchin is of Italian origin, derived from the personal name Bacchini, which is a diminutive form of the name Bacchus. Bacchus was the Roman god of wine, revelry, and ecstasy, making it a popular name among the Romans. Over time, the name Bacchini evolved into the surname Bacchin, which has spread to various countries around the world.
Italy
In Italy, the surname Bacchin is most common, with a total of 2,114 incidences. The name likely originated in the northern regions of Italy, such as Veneto or Friuli-Venezia Giulia, where wine production is a significant industry. The presence of the surname Bacchin in Italy can be traced back to ancient Roman times, where it was likely used as a nickname for someone associated with winemaking or revelry.
Brazil
In Brazil, the surname Bacchin is also relatively common, with 400 incidences. The name likely arrived in Brazil through Italian immigrants who settled in the country during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. These immigrants brought with them their culture, including their surnames, which have since become integrated into Brazilian society.
